Silence the Drip, Save Your Bucks: Identifying and Repairing Pool Leaks
A dripping pool isn't just a nuisance; it can waste your money and put a burden on your equipment. Luckily, most pool leaks are solvable with a little searching. Start by meticulously observing the pool's edges for any signs of cracks. Check your filtration unit for issues and make sure all connections are secure. If you can't identify the leak yourself, don't delay to call a technician. They have the resources and expertise to find the problem and get your pool back in shape.
- Suggestion: Check your water level regularly. A sharp reduction could indicate a leak.
- Advice: Listen for any gurgling sounds coming from the pool area, especially at night when it's quieter.

Pool Leak Severity
Dealing with a pool leak can be a stressful experience, ranging from minor annoyance to major headache. Identifying the severity of your leak is crucial for determining the best course of action. A small leak, often indicated by a steady drip or slow water level decline, might only require simple repairs. However, larger leaks can manifest as significant water loss, constant sounds coming from the pool, and even structural damage to your pool's shell.
Don't hesitate to address any signs of a leak, as prompt action can help prevent further damage and costly repairs. A professional pool technician can identify the source of the leak and recommend the most appropriate solution.
